This release sees the introduction of a brand new graphical user interface, Mantid Workbench, which will eventually replace MantidPlot. The Mantid Workbench has been built from the ground up to allow more automated testing in an effort to vastly improve on the stability of MantidPlot. In addition it offers: * matplotlib-based plotting: Matplotlib is the de-facto standard plotting package for the scientific community and one of its core goals is to produce publication-quality plots * cleaner interface: MantidPlot had many toolbars, buttons and menus that would confuse new users. Mantid Workbench aims to have a simpler interface and removes many legacy tools that were unused from MantidPlot * support for high-dpi displays: Based on Qt5, allowing for improved handling of high-resolution screens such as retina displays Please see the full workbench release notes for more information along with the new documentation.
